Description

The Ibanez BL700 Blazer Bass is a testament to the classic, high-quality craftsmanship that Ibanez is renowned for. As part of the coveted Blazer series, this electric bass is designed to cater to both budding musicians and seasoned bassists seeking a reliable instrument with a touch of vintage flair. The BL700 offers a well-balanced, resonant tone thanks to its solid body construction, making it versatile enough for various musical genres.

Equipped with a smooth neck profile, the BL700 ensures comfortable playability, whether you're navigating intricate solos or laying down a solid groove. Its precision-engineered pickups deliver a clear, punchy sound that can cut through any band mix, allowing you to stand out on stage or in the studio. The intuitive control layout gives you the flexibility to shape your tone with ease, offering a seamless playing experience.

Product specs

Brand Ibanez
Model BL700-NT Blazer Bass, BL700-TV Blazer Bass
Year 1980 - 1982
Made In Japan
Categories 4-String Basses
Active / Passive Pickups Passive Pickups
Active Preamp No Preamp
Body Material Ash
Body Shape P-Style
Color Family Brown, Natural
Finish Style Gloss
Fretboard Material Maple
Model Family Ibanez Blazer
Neck Material Maple
Number of Frets 21
Number of Strings 4-String
Pickup Configuration Split-Coil
Right / Left Handed Right Handed
Scale Length 34"

FAQs

What kind of sound can I expect from the Ibanez BL700 Blazer Bass?

The Ibanez BL700 Blazer Bass offers a warm, full-bodied sound typical of passive split-coil pickups, making it versatile for a range of genres from rock to funk.

Is the Ibanez BL700 Blazer Bass suitable for beginner bassists?

Yes, the Ibanez BL700 Blazer Bass is suitable for beginners due to its comfortable P-style body shape and manageable 34" scale length.

What materials are used in the construction of the Ibanez BL700 Blazer Bass?

The Ibanez BL700 Blazer Bass features a solid ash body and a maple neck and fretboard, which contribute to its bright tonal characteristics.

Does the Ibanez BL700 Blazer Bass have active electronics?

No, the Ibanez BL700 Blazer Bass uses passive electronics, which provide a more traditional, organic bass tone.

How many frets does the Ibanez BL700 Blazer Bass have?

The Ibanez BL700 Blazer Bass has 21 frets, allowing for a wide range of notes and playing styles.
